About the partnership

Soybean POs supported by 2SCALE were progressively linked to small local processors, like CTAE and women processors producing soy-products for street vendors and local restaurants. These processors have become the drivers of the partnership, which aims to develop markets of soy-based products, as nutritious substitutes to meat and innovative BoP food-products (e.g., goussi). Women being key in this partnership (as processors, farmers and retailers), the partnership mainstreams gender throughout its interventions.

Achievements
Promote the use of Rhizobium inoculant by farmers
Strengthen linkages and facilitate contracting and coordination among POs, processors and women processing groups
Facilitate access to finance for processors and farmers
Pilot and roll-out BoP marketing plans for soy-goussi and soy-cheese
Targets:
The partnership aims to involve 8,000 smallholder farmers (3,000 women), and 100 SMEs (80 female-headed) in the soy industry.
Market Segments:
Soy-based products (kebabs, cheese, milk, oil) for local and urban markets. Soy-goussi for BoP consumers.
Project partners
ALIDé and FECECAM (finance)
AMAB (insurance)
FUPRO (national PO)
University of Calavi (inoculants)
AGRITERRA (technical partner)
ProSAM (supporter)
